18

私は自分のデスクトップでWindows7をOSとしてXAMPPパッケージを使用しています。
つまり、MySQLDBとApacheサーバーを使用しています。

次に、MySQL DB全体を友人のデスクトップにコピー/移行します。このデスクトップもOSとしてWindowを使用し、XAMPPパッケージも使用しています。

私がそれをする方法はありますか?

4

8 に答える 8

46

sharebin、およびscriptフォルダーを除くMySQL フォルダー (古いxamppフォルダーの下) からデータベース ファイルをコピーし、添付の画像を参照して、コピーが必要なファイル (緑色のボックス内のファイルのみ) を確認し、MySQL に新しくインストールされたxamppディレクトリにあるこれらすべてのデータベース ファイルを置き換えます。フォルダ。

xampp start MySQL を再起動し、データベースとテーブルを開いて、動作することを確認します。

緑の線で置換するファイル

于 2016-12-29T15:37:43.153 に答える
10

はい。コマンドラインツールを使用できますmysqldump

データベースを保存する

mysqldump -u[yourusername] -p[yourpassword] --all-databases > mydump.sql

読み返して:

mysql -u[yourusername] -p[yourpassword] < mydump.sql

mysqlbinディレクトリにはコマンドラインからアクセスできると思います。[yourusername]と[yourpassword]は角かっこなしで記述する必要があります。

于 2012-03-25T12:37:26.650 に答える
4

このアドレスhttp://127.0.0.1/に移動し 、次のphpmyadminでデータベースを選択し、[エクスポート]をクリックして列を選択します...そして[移動]をクリックします

ファイルをサーバーにコピーし、サーバーのphpmyadminに移動し、[インポート]をクリックしてファイルデータベースを追加し、楽しんでください。

于 2012-03-25T12:36:10.990 に答える
0

バージョンとdatadirの設定は何ですか?datadirのデフォルトはC:\ Program Files \ MySQL \ MySQL Server 5.0\dataのようなものです

そのフォルダを圧縮して、同じ場所の新しいサーバー(mysqlサーバーが両方のサーバーをシャットダウンした場合)で解凍し、そこでmysqlサーバーを起動するだけです。これは、datadir設定が両方のサーバーで同じであることを前提としています。

于 2012-03-25T12:37:12.963 に答える
0

コマンドラインからmysqldumpを使用してデータベースをダンプできます。データベースがインストールされている場合は、PHPMyAdminを使用して、データベースを友人のコンピューターにインポートできます。

于 2012-03-25T12:35:23.550 に答える
0

PhPmyAdminで、[エクスポート]に移動し、あるコンピューターでエクスポートしてから、別のコンピューターでインポートを使用します

SQLスクリプトが最適なオプションです。でも本当にどんな仕事でも

于 2012-03-25T12:35:46.623 に答える
0

DBを開いphpmyadminxamppファイルにダンプしてから、別のPCに送信してインポートすることphpmyadminもできます。

于 2012-03-25T12:36:36.163 に答える